2. Product Description and Benefits

Overview

The galvanized pressed steel modular panel water tank is engineered from Q235 pressed steel with a hot dip galvanized (HDG) zinc layer typically around 90 μm. This hot dip galvanized steel water tank system is modular, allowing flexible panel arrangement and custom capacities ranging from 0.125 m³ to 5,000 m³. Configurations commonly use 500 x 500 mm, 1000 x 500 mm, 1000 x 1000 mm, and 1220 x 1220 mm panels to meet practical installation and transport requirements.

Design and Components

The assembly consists of four principal groups of components:

  1. Panels — bottom, wall, roof panels and manhole panels formed by precision pressing.
  2. Internal fittings — internal ladders, tie-rod assemblies, supports, flanges and sealing rubber.
  3. External fittings — exterior ladders, angle irons, tie-piece boards, bolts and nuts for robust fastening.
  4. U-steel base — available in painted, hot-dip galvanized or stainless steel finishes depending on site conditions.

Key Advantages

  • Superior corrosion protection: the hot-dip galvanizing zinc layer forms a durable barrier that prevents rust and extends service life — typically providing at least a decade of effective protection under normal conditions.
  • Strength and load capacity: Q235 pressed steel panels deliver structural strength to resist hydrostatic pressure and external loads, making the tanks suitable for aboveground and underground installations.
  • Modularity and cost-effectiveness: a wide array of panel sizes and thicknesses permits optimized designs that reduce material waste and transportation costs while scaling capacity to project needs.
  • Low maintenance: HDG surfaces reduce the frequency and cost of routine upkeep; inspections and occasional replacement of seals or bolts are typically sufficient.
  • Customizable: tanks can be delivered with various access, piping, and mounting options to integrate with filtration, circulation or process systems.

Installation, Use and Maintenance Notes

Installation should follow manufacturer assembly instructions, ensuring correct sealant application between panels and proper torque for fasteners. Standard practice limits tank height to 4 meters for typical panel assemblies; however, length and width can be scaled to project needs. For underground use, choose the appropriate U-steel base treatment and confirm soil, groundwater and loading conditions with a qualified engineer. Routine inspections should focus on seals, fastener integrity, and any local coating damage; repair or local touch-up of the zinc layer and sealants will preserve longevity.

Compliance and selection guidance

Select panel thickness and base treatment consistent with operating height, fluid type (e.g., sea water may require additional considerations), and local regulations. For buried installations, consult geotechnical and structural guidance to confirm suitability of hot dip galvanized surfaces and base options.
